    Role Responsibilities

    • Deliver engaging classroom training, both virtually and in person, for our customers, partners, and members of our internal sales force.
    • Develop and maintain expertise on your designated Brand and Products.
    • Continually identify learning needs of target audiences and seek out opportunities to expand our customer reach.
    • Collaborate with Training Manager to improve training materials and share innovating ideas and stay up to date on trends in the product and customer training fields.
    • Participate in Train-the-Trainer session with large accounts.
    • Keep stakeholders up to date on the status, effectiveness, and roadmap of your training programs to foster maximum utilization of your expertise and training.
    • Assist the Training Team as needed for consistency in training deliveries and philosophies.

    Qualifications

    • Bachelors degree in business, engineering, education, communications, or other related program of study preferred.
    • Proficient in delivering technical training using learner-focused activities for a broad range of audiences.
    • Experience in the Electronic Security Industry (CCTV, Access Control) preferred.
    • Experience in training performance coaching and enablement
    • High proficiency in Microsoft Office suite
    • Excellent presentation and verbal communication skills, both in-person and virtually
    • Experience managing classroom groups of up to 15 participants and facilitating breakout and group activities.
    • Ability to travel for business needs.
    • Ability to lift training material up to 50 pounds.
